Suevite

Encyclopedia of Astrobiology

Synonyms

Mixed breccia; Suevite breccia; Suevitic impact breccia

Definition

Suevite is a term referred to a polimictic breccia made of melt and solid fragments floating in a fine pulverized clastic matrix. The clastic matrix contains lithic and mineral clasts in various stages of shock metamorphism produced during an impact. Initially used for describing impact breccia in the Nördlinger Ries (called also Ries crater), Germany, it is now a generalized term for describing similar brecciated rocks (impactites) found in impact craters.
